Tails-san Posted August 9, 2014 Share Posted August 9, 2014 (edited) All weapons benefit the same percentage of damage from channeling. Percentage, yes, but not amount of damage, and they also all have the same channeling cost per hit. This means that channeling gives you more extra damage per energy on higher-damage weapons. Darzk Posted August 9, 2014 Share Posted August 9, 2014 If you use Killing Blow and Reflex Coil instead of two elements, you're going to do about 30% more damage per attack, at the cost of one energy/swing. However, if you channeled with the element setup, you'd do more damage at a much higher cost. Because you can channel just the special hits, it makes far more sense to not channel most attacks and only channel the finishers - you'd get higher DPS and probably less energy used. Any weapon with a high attack rate will have poor channel efficiency. This holds true for all weapons with decent crit and Zerker installed. My 'general' advice would be to ignore channeling mods, and only channel special hits, slide attacks and finishers. The only setup that works well for Channeling is with a frame setup (no shields and rage, or trinity) that allows you to use a channel build WITHOUT installing Reflex Coil.
